Silversmiths We are working on both fabrication and lost wax casting this year. The silver bracelet was fabricated with the addition of cast flowers. The copper bracelet is fabricated with several strands of copper wire that has been twisted and soldered at both ends before reforming. Both methods can be fun and very creative, the two methods can be combined to create a totally unique object.
